The head bolts on the Mercruiser 7.4 have to have sealer applied to their threads because they enter the coolant passages. I wirebrushed each bolt (electric wirebrush in a drill) and then coated each with airplane sealer before threading them into the block. Tightening is done is three stages. What was a real PITA was that the tightening diagram was facing one way and the head facing the other way. The numbering on the diagram was also very small. Yes, I should have re-written the numbers larger and in the right direction before I began, but why do things the easy way when one can make them more difficult without even trying! The head bolts on that engine are the old-fashioned ones; they don't stretch to lock. Heading out to dinner -Italian food _ to celebrate. Hy

JD: Then I'd look for a frozen caliper, very common. In most cases, the remedy is to disconnect the fluid line and force the caliper open with two large screwdrivers. I don't recommend trying to rebuild the caliper yourself. They rarely work out OK. You can buy a new, rebuilt, or used caliper. Be sure to flush and bleed the brake lines. Check the other rear caliper also. I recommend replacing the slide bolts and boots at the same time. I've had to do that on a Toyota and a 350Z we've owned. The smallblock intake manifold gaskets now recommend just putting a bead of silicone on the front and rear rail. It doesn't have to be an air tight seal but the silicone does it anyway.

If you ever have to go into the bottom end, get the one piece silicone oil pan gasket. It has saved me a lot of time because it is made to be reused. I've had to pull the pan 4-5 times because of my bad short term memory. I don't remember torquing all the bolts...and there's a lot of them in there.
 
Charlie: The engines are big block GM 7.4. Most of the gaskets sets I had bought had rubber end gaskets with locator pins, easy to keep in place. The one set I had gotten had the old-style cork gaskets which are held in place with gasket shellac, a real PITA. The intake manifold itself is heavy and awkward. In addition, the forward end has a small, male hose fitting which has to be slipped into the small bypass hose while holding the manifold in the air! I added antifreeze to the starboard engine's cooling system and ran it while flowing 2-cycle oil through the fuel system and winterizing antifreeze through the skimmer intake. I shut it down and disconnected the batteries. I wanted to add a liuttle more two-cycle oil to the port engine, but it wouldn't turn over. Thinking I had a dead battery, I let it go. On the way home I got to thinking about the engine not starting. It ran last week, and the batteries were on the charger the entire time I was there last week and today. Realization! The engine's hydrolocked with antifreeze! I haven't fixed the problem I had been having all season. The only possible source has to be cracks in the exhaust manifolds. Nothing else makes sense. I'm going to pull the plugs on Wednesday and spin the engine just to get any coolant out of the cylinders. If, as I suspect, there's fluid in the cylinders, I'm back to square one. I'll fog the cylinders and, sometime over the winter, pull all four exhaust manifolds to test them for cracks. I'm open to any other suggestions. Hy
 
This makes me just about too sick to reply. Heads were tested as part of the overhauls, right? Block isn't cracked... Leaves exhaust, I guess...hope? Can you get oil to the valve guides? I maybe wrong in this (and hope so!) but it seems to me the antifreeze could get to the valve stems and guides.
Did you notice, or can you check, if the starter is loose? An engine that's trying to start with water in the cylinders can stretch the starter mounting bolts, making us think they worked loose. Loose starter could point to a longer term water ingestion issue.
